Exploring the Influence of Climate and Geography on Coffee Bean Origins

Coffee is one of the most popular and beloved beverages in the world, with an estimated 2.25 billion cups consumed daily. But have you ever wondered where your morning cup of coffee comes from, and how the climate and geography of that region influence the taste and quality of the beans? In this article, we will explore the impact of climate and geography on coffee bean origins and how these factors contribute to the unique flavors and characteristics of different coffee varieties.

Climate and Coffee Bean Origins

Climate plays a crucial role in determining the growing conditions for coffee beans and ultimately influences their flavor profile. Coffee plants thrive in tropical climates with consistent temperatures, ample sunlight, and well-distributed rainfall. The two main types of coffee beans, Arabica and Robusta, have different climate requirements and growing conditions.

Arabica beans, which account for the majority of coffee production worldwide, are grown in higher altitudes with cooler temperatures and more rainfall. These beans are known for their delicate flavors, acidity, and complexity. Arabica beans are typically grown in regions like Central and South America, Africa, and parts of Southeast Asia, where the climate is ideal for producing high-quality coffee.

Robusta beans, on the other hand, are grown in lower altitudes with hotter temperatures and less rainfall. Robusta beans are known for their strong, bold flavors, higher caffeine content, and earthy notes. These beans are commonly grown in regions like Africa, Southeast Asia, and parts of South America, where the climate is more conducive to their cultivation.

Geography and Coffee Bean Origins

In addition to climate, geography also plays a significant role in determining the flavor profile of coffee beans. The soil composition, elevation, and proximity to bodies of water all contribute to the unique characteristics of coffee from different regions.

For example, coffee beans grown in volcanic soil, such as those from regions like Guatemala and Hawaii, are known for their rich, complex flavors and distinctive profiles. The mineral-rich soil and unique microclimates created by volcanic activity contribute to the quality and flavor of these beans.

Elevation is another important factor in determining the quality of coffee beans. Higher-altitude coffee farms, where the beans are grown at elevations of 1,200 meters or more, produce beans with more pronounced acidity, complex flavors, and a higher level of sweetness. These beans are often prized for their exceptional quality and unique taste profile.

Proximity to bodies of water, such as oceans or lakes, can also influence the flavor of coffee beans. The moisture in the air and the cooling effect of bodies of water can create unique microclimates that affect the growing conditions and quality of the beans. Coffee beans grown near water sources may have a smoother, more rounded flavor profile compared to beans grown in drier, inland regions.
